Two days after robbers made off with 6kg gold, other ornaments and cash from the house of a local jeweller, five-six unidentified persons seriouly injured a trader and robbed him of Rs 1.49 lakh, a mobile phone and a gold chain near Hassanpura village on Friday evening.

Victim Mangal Das of Jaintipur village was on way to home in his milk van after collecting payments when the suspects riding two motorcycles stopped him near Hasanpura village.
They asked Mangal to hand over cash and gold chain to them, but when he resisted, the suspects attacked him with sharp-edged weapons. After leaving him seriously injured, they fled with cash and other valuables.
On receipt of information, police rushed to the spot and took the victim to the local civil hospital.
On April 4, seven-eight unidentified persons had decamped with ornaments from the Basent Nagar residence of a jeweller after threatening the family members.
